Selection is one of plant breeding techniques to obtain a desired character. The objective of this research was to determine information about the trait variance in F3 lines in terms of yield and yield components, knowing character could be improved through selection to obtain high yield lines. This study was conducted on june until august 2020 in the village Karang Bangun Rambung Merah Kecamatan Pematangsiantar, kabupaten Simalungun 500-550 with an elevation place, use augmented design. 20 × 30 cm plant distance, data observed for each individual plant, and done to find genetic variance, environment variance, phenotif variance, GCV, broad-sense heritability and Coefficient correlation. The result show that the value of heritability all character was moderate until high except the days of harvest was low. The value of GCV was narrow to the days to flowering and harvest, while other character value of the GCV was moderate until broad. Coefficient correlation indicated that Seed weight per plant was positively and significantly correlated with all studied traits except the days to flowering was negative and non-significant. Based on high heritability and broad GCV, selection process on seed weight per plant so 10 selected lines with highest seed weight.
